Confirmed Nigeria starting XI: Rangers duo, Iheanacho, Awaziem start; ex-Chelsea stars bench
Published: October 10, 2021
Nigeria manager Gernot Rohr has announced his starting line-up for Sunday afternoon's 2022 World Cup qualifying match against Central African Republic at Stade Omnisport de Bepanda in Douala.
Rohr suggested pre-match that he was going to make two or three changes to the team that lost 1-0 in the first leg three days ago.
One of those changes sees Maduka Okoye replace Francis Uzoho in between the pipes.
It will be a back three of Leon Balogun, William Troost-Ekong and Chidozie Awaziem in front of the Sparta Rotterdam goalkeeper.
In what appears to be a 3-5-2 formation, Jamilu Collins and Moses Simon will operate as the left and right wing-back respectively.
Former Chelsea stars Ola Aina and Kenneth Omeruo have both missed out on the starting line-up and will initially watch proceedings from the bench.
Brentford midfielder Frank Onyeka makes his second consecutive start for the Super Eagles for the first time in his career and joining him in the middle of the park is Joe Aribo, while Kelechi Iheanacho has been handed playmaking duties.
Victor Osimhen will spear-head the attack, and will be supported by captain Ahmed Musa.
Nigeria starting line-up vs CAR : Okoye; Awaziem, Balogun, Troost-Ekong; Simon, Aribo, Onyeka, Collins, Iheanacho; Osimhen, Musa.
